Jacobson injury hits Pirates plans

Sun 27 Jul, 03:45 PM


Bristol Rovers' win over IF Limhamn Bunkeflo 2007 was marred by injury to Joe Jacobson, who could miss the opening day of the season.Darryl Duffy's stunning strike ensured Rovers ended their Scandinavian tour on a winning note with a 1-0 victory.

But the win came at a cost as defender Jacobson was stretchered off shortly after the break.

Club doctors later ruled out a leg break, but Jacobson suffered medial knee ligament damage and could be ruled out for several weeks.
